Segment 2: Let’s now talk about the show itself. The show aired from 2001-2006 on ABC and launched the careers of many young Hollywood stars. It was created by JJ Abrams, whose only TV credit before this was Felicity (which is also being reviewed on this network!). Abrams cast Jennifer Garner on the show (where she appeared as Hannah in the first season) and at some point wondered “what if Felicity was a spy?” And so the idea was born. Of course, today everyone knows who JJ Abrams is. He’s gone on to produce several TV series, including Lost, Fringe and Person of Interest, just to name a few and has produced many films including the Star Trek reboot trilogy and Star Wars: The Force Awakens, just to name a few.

The cast is really fantastic, and 15 years ago when the show premiered many of them were not well known. Several have since gone on to other roles.

Jennifer Garner as Sydney Bristow
Ron Rifkin as Arvin Sloane
Michael Vartan as Michael Vaughn
Bradley Cooper as Will Tippin
Merrin Dungey as Francie Calfo
Carl Lumbly as Marcus Dixon
Kevin Weisman as Marshall Flinkman
Victor Garber as Jack Bristow
Greg Grunberg as Eric Weiss

Other notable recurring characters: Terry O’Quinn, David Anders, Sarah Shahi (and many more as the show continues. We’ll note them as the episodes go)
